Students will demonstrate their understanding of the mathematical/geometric skills and concepts by applying them to real-live scenarios. They will design and build a model/replica of their dream home or a home that addresses a social cause such as homelessness in our community.
They will apply many mathematical (geometric) concepts such as scale drawing, transformations, budgeting, area, and perimeter. Each student will create a unique version based on their own ideas, imagination, and application of skills. Additionally, this project based learning activity integrates multiple elements such as problem solving, collaboration, design, and planning that connects the activity to real-life applications.
The geometric tools such as compasses, protractor, and straight edges will allow students to measure and construct accurate scale drawings. The calculator will allow them to perform complex mathematical calculations used in determining correct measurements and accurate budgets.
